WISCONSIN (CBS 58) -- State Fair is now just two days away, and Tuesday night, celebrity judges declared the winners of the Sporkies and Drinkies competition.
CBS 58
The judges ate and drank each of what the finalists had to offer, choosing only the most delicious of the offerings.
"The winner gets signs put next to their vendor station that says Sporkies and Drinkies winner, and they get long lines and crowds because everybody loves their food and drink," said Jennifer Billock, one of the judges.
The first-place Sporkies winner is the Birria Flamin' Bombs from Fiesta Grill & Cantina. It's made with slow-cooked beef birria, cilantro, onion, and melted mozzarella cheese, coated in seasoned breadcrumbs.
The first-place Drinkies winner is the Tilt-A-Spritz from the Old Fashioned Sipper Club. It has ruby red grapefruit and key lime with ginger beer effervescence.
